Lahore Stock Market remained in the negative mode on Tuesday, as the LSE-25 Index decreased by four points to close at 5,352 points.
Trading volumes were lower than those recorded a day ago.
Of the 13 companies traded, the value of five increased; eight declined, while no company was traded at the same value.
Trading volume was 1.75 million shares, higher than 2.2 million shares recorded a day ago. Bank of Punjab was the volume leader with a turnover of 725,000 million shares. NOPK Limited was the major gainer with an increase of Rs13.50 per share. Fauji Fertilizer was the top loser with a decline of Rs1.76 per share.
